Skip to content

Common Desktop IDE


For software developers, we listed some common IDE below, so you can build your desktop development environment easily!

More importantly, if you are interested in IoT, you could control the physical world and get the sensor data easily by Arduino in different types of programming languages.

Enjoy Coding! Enjoy IoT!

Common IDE

Arduino IDE ( For IoT )

The LattePanda is born with a ATmega32U4 chip on the board (which is known as Arduino Leonardo), so it's perfect for IoT and industry automation project.

Download the Arduino IDE here.

Visual Studio (C, C#, C++, JavaScript Developer)

Microsoft Visual Studio is an integrated development environment (IDE) from Microsoft. It is used to develop computer programs, as well as web sites, web apps, web services and mobile apps. Visual Studio uses Microsoft software development platforms such as Windows API, Windows Forms, Windows Presentation Foundation, etc.

Download the Visual Studio here.

Tutorial: Control the physical world in C#.

Tutorial: Get sensor data in C#.

Python IDLE (Python Developer)

It's a Python IDE for Python Developers.

Download the Python IDLE here.

If you are familiar with Python and have interested in IoT, see the tutorial below.

Tutorial: Control the physical world in Python.

Tutorial: Get the sensor data in Python.

Eclipse (Java Developer)

Eclipse is an integrated development environment(IDE) used in computer programming, and is the most widely used Java IDE. It contains a base workspace and an extensible plug-in system for customizing the environment.

Download Eclipse here.

[Coming Soon] Tutorial: Control the physical world in Java.

[Coming Soon] Tutorial: Get the sensor data in Java.